Unlike ordinary materials and models, Redshift cannot separate fluids through direct AOV. If you render the fluid separately, you can use the Denoise noise reduction that comes with Redshift, which will be faster. Therefore, you can increase the sampling of the light source. The parameter that affects the noise of the fluid is mainly the light source that illuminates the fluid (you need to increase the Samples under the Volume label). It is recommended to perform regional rendering and bucket rendering to observe local fluid details. ![]() In this case, if you want to simulate the light and thin smoke, so lower the New Max in the Density Remap Range, the following is a comparison chart.ĭuring real-time preview, the fluid is displayed as dots. In the Volume node's Advanced tab, you can adjust the overall transparency and projection of the fluid. ![]() These two parameters need to be adjusted at the same time.Ĭomparative image of 2 parameters in the official document Volume material is also very simple to take, no additional nodes are needed, all settings can be done in Redshift Volume.įor smoke (non-luminous), the most important are Scatter and Absorption. The higher this value, the more the fluid is affected by the light source.Ĭreate a new Redshift Volume material and point it to the TFD Container. If you want the smoke fluid to be illuminated by the same light source, then you need to increase the value of Contribution Scale under the Volume tab of Dome Light. To render a flame with smoke, you need to set the Scatter and Emission channel sources in the Volume material.Īs shown above, there is a solved TFD Container in the scene. At the same time, add the Redshift Volume material to the TFD Container. Lighting smoke requires adding Redshift lights and increasing the Contribution Scale in the Volume tab of the lights. With Redshift, the smoke of the TFD can be illuminated by the scene light, and if it is a simulated flame, the flame itself can provide a true global light illumination effect as a light source.
